17th Century Cavalier Scene Miniature Painting art nouveau It's fashioned in 18 karatDATE: 17th Century Framed miniature painting depicting a cavalier scene (?) with soldiers and villagers in various stages of revelry, dated 1683. Some are dining on trestle tables, others dancing, and some clinking beer mugs on horseback all taking place around what appears to be an army encampment on the outskirts of a Tudor village, a lake and mountains in the distance behind.
